Tour CB21

Tour CB21, formerly Tour Gan, is an office skyscraper located in , the high-rise business district situated west of , . It was designed by celebrated American architect Max Abramovitz.

Metro station
Esplanade de La Défense is a station on Paris Métro Line 1 on the outskirts of on the border of and . It has an island platform because of limitations on space due it being enclosed in a site originally earmarked for one of the underpasses of the A14 autoroute.
